Chipped Keys
Transponder chips can be found in modern cars. This is an excellent anti-theft measure as it means that only the key with the correct information will be able to start your vehicle.
When you turn on the ignition the chip sends an alert to your car's ECU. This then examines the digital serial numbers on the chip with those stored in the vehicle. If they are compatible the immobilizer will be disengaged and the car will start. The ECU will ignore the key if it does not have the correct serial number.
It is possible to determine the presence of chip by looking carefully. The hole in the key's head is often offset to one side. This is to accommodate the microchip. Earlier keys used to have the chip in the middle of the head of the key. You can also verify this by using a transponder scanner, which will read the data stored on the chip and display it on the screen.

Transponder Chips
All modern renault kadjar key card keys are equipped with a transponder (also known as a "chip-key"). The chip is an electronic micro-circuit that communicates with the car's ECU to unlock the doors and begin the engine. When your car key is put into the ignition the antenna ring at the ignition emits an impulsive radio frequency energy, which reaches the transponder chip. The chip sends out an electronic signal that contains an unique code. The ECU examines this code to determine whether the key is legitimate to operate the car. This helps to reduce the risk of theft from cars since keys aren't merely a flat metal key that can be copied easily and easily, but instead have an extra layer of security to prevent unauthorised access to the vehicle.
Older cars with no transponder chips were very simple to duplicate and car thieves could easily steal vehicles. Since most cars made after 1995 are equipped with transponders, this type of crime is much less common. This is due to the fact that the microchip in a car can only be activated with the appropriate key. It is unique to the car. If someone attempts to start your car using an unprogrammed transponder key that hasn't been programmed with the car you own, the ECU won't recognize it and refuse to start.

Immobilisers
Car immobilisers are a vital part of your vehicle security. They protect your Renault from being started by the wrong key, thereby protecting your car against theft. Since 1998, immobilisers are required for all new cars in the UK. However, many older vehicles are equipped with them. These devices are a great way to increase the security of your car and can even lower the cost of insurance.
The first automobile immobilisers were introduced in 1992, and most luxury automakers incorporated them into their vehicles shortly after. They are designed to prevent the engine from running if the correct key isn't present or when the transponder chip inside the fob is not recognized by the electronic control unit (ECU).
When you insert your smart keys into your vehicle, they transmit a code to the ECU which must be compatible with the code for the engine to start. If the codes don't match the ECU disables several key vehicle components, including the starter motor and the fuel system.
If you own an older Renault key that is not equipped with the security feature, you can purchase a new one and benefit from this extra layer of security. It is important that you make sure the new key is Thatcham-approved and has been programmed to work with your car.
Some tech-savvy thieves have devised methods to evade anti-immobilisers that are factory fitted. These tricks involve using devices that can duplicate the pin code from your key, and then transmit it to the ECU to fool it into believing that your key is there. This is known as relay theft and is a common issue for [Redirect-307] those who have modern-day keyless entry and start-up vehicles.
This can be avoided by ensuring that your smart key is properly programmed for your vehicle and keeping it out of the hands of people who are suspicious.
